Natural Acne Treatment Northern Virginia

Acne is one of the most common skin conditions in the world. While some cases of acne require medical treatment, not all will. There are many natural acne treatments in Northern Virginia for patients looking for alternative treatment options.

It’s important to note that most home remedies lack scientific backing or need further research, but here are some of the most common alternative treatments for acne.

Topical Natural Remedies for Acne

• Tea Tree Oil – May fight acne causing bacteria but should be diluted with carrier oil. May cause dry skin.

• Aloe Vera – Anti-inflammatory, antibacterial and moisturizes skin. Contains salicylic acid and sulfur, both of which are used to treat acne. Choose products without additives.

• Raw Honey – Antibacterial, anti-inflammatory. Can be used as a mask or spot treatment.

• Apple Cider Vinegar – Fights bacteria but may irritate skin. Dilute with water before applying it to skin.

• Witch Hazel – Removes excess oil, fights bacteria and reduces irritation and inflammation.

• Green Tea – Cooled green tea reduces sebum production and inflammation.

Diet and Lifestyle Changes

There are many things you can do in your daily life that may help reduce your acne breakouts.

• Dietary Changes – Reducing sugar intake and avoiding high glycemic foods while increasing your omega-3 fatty acids and zinc rich foods can help balance hormones and reduce inflammation. This could help improve acne and prevent future breakouts.

• Zinc Supplements – 40mg taken daily it may improve acne. You can also increase your intake of zinc rich foods such as:

• Oysters

• Red meat

• Dark meat chicken

• Pork

• Seafood

• Hemp seeds

• Pumpkin seeds

• Other nuts

• Legumes such as chickpeas, lentils, and kidney beans

• Fish Oil Supplements – Contain omega-3 fatty acids that can decrease inflammation and reduce risk of acne. Other sources of omega-3 fatty acids include:

• Salmon

• Walnuts

• Chia seeds

• Ground flax seeds

• Anchovies

• Managing Stress – Reducing stress can reduce cortisol, which worsens acne. Practice good stress management and proper sleep to help control acne.
